Inhibitor Solenoid Replacement

  1. Remove the lower valve body (see LOWER VALVE BODY REMOVAL/INSTALLATION  ).
  2. Disconnect the inhibitor solenoid connector (A).

  3. Remove the inhibitor solenoid (B), then remove the O-rings (C) from the inhibitor solenoid.
  4. Install new O-rings on a new inhibitor solenoid, then install the inhibitor solenoid on the CVT driven pulley pressure control valve.
  5. Connect the inhibitor solenoid connector.
  6. Install the lower valve body (see LOWER VALVE BODY REMOVAL/INSTALLATION  ).
